roboforum.ru

Технический форум по робототехнике.
Текущее время: 04 дек 2024, 20:02

Часовой пояс: UTC + 4 часа


Правила форума


В этом форуме новые темы не создаются, однако обсуждение допустимо.



Начать новую тему Ответить на тему  [ Сообщений: 260 ]  На страницу Пред.  1 ... 7, 8, 9, 10, 11, 12, 13 ... 18  След.
Автор Сообщение
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 13 май 2012, 10:44 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
Тестов я не находил. Да и по поводу того что mr3020 хуже 320 я не говорил, наоборот я считаю что он лучше, кроме антены.
Мне хватило того, что люди жалуются на то, что бетонную стену сигнал не пробивает. Возможно меня здесь кто то переубедт в этом.
Это пожалуй единственное что меня останавливает перед покупкой.
Как по мне, то смысла использовать вайфай нет, если у него будет маленький радиус действия.

Ну а по поводу того что все рассчитано.. оно то конечно так, но по большому счету роутеры не расчитаны на то что бы быть приемо-передатчиками в роботах :) . Всегда есть какой то резервный запас или в крайнем случае какое то альтернативное решение.

P.S. Возможно есть какое то "дело благодарное", что б усилить сигнал антенны? :D


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 13 май 2012, 10:47 
Не в сети
Аватара пользователя

Зарегистрирован: 15 сен 2007, 13:03
Сообщения: 6338
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ович
роутер/АР в режиме репитера ))

_________________
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 17 май 2012, 22:58 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
Купил все таки роутер mr3020. Прошил под openWRT, установил веб морду и почти все пакеты которые применялись в дире320 (почти все потому что места не хватило :lol: ), не устанавливал пакеты для видео по usb, пока видео тестировать не на чем...

В этот раз уже без всяких ком портов соединил uart роутера с arduino напрямую.
Получилась такая штука :oops:

Изображение
соединено пока не очень надежно но контакт есть, проверял.

4 светодиода слева - будущие выходы для моторов, 3 светодиода справа просто индикаторы..

При запуске роутера светодиод на 7 порту начинает мигать (точно также как в дире320 когда погружаться отладочная консоль, или приходит что то из сериала)

Но когда я пытаюсь отправить сообщение в uart той же командой echo “hi, comp”>/dev/ttyS0 то выбивает ошибку "Command 'pwd' failed with return code 0 and error message ash: write error: Input/output error." Возможно тут как то по другому нужно..
Ставил прошивку orWRT, так там вообще все просто в веб морде есть поле для отправки в сериал напрямую - тоже не помогло. Светодиод на 7 порту так и не мигнул..

Наверно что то делаю не так, скорее всего проблема в setserial и в его настройках, если использовать настройки которые были в дире320, то setserial отказывается запускаться.., а на своих работать не хочет как нужно.

Буду разбираться, возможно вы мне поможите :D


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 00:58 
Не в сети
Аватара пользователя

Зарегистрирован: 10 ноя 2011, 12:02
Сообщения: 5691
Откуда: Turku, Finland
Skype: elmot73
прог. языки: Java и все-все=все
ФИО: Илья
На этом чипсете UART называется /dev/ttyATH0, не /dev/ttyS0


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 07:00 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
Ну совсем другое дело :good:

Стоило только заменить на /dev/ttyATH0 - сразу светодиод на 7 порту стал мигать когда я что то отправлял, а когда настроил скорость, стало даже проходить правильно авторизацию.

Единственное чего пока не понял так это, почему когда я проверял прошивку ардуино через встроенный Serial monitor (arduino 1.0) после авторизации, я отправлял например цифры 1,2,4,8 - соответственно и загорались светодиоды которые слева (на моторы).

Теперь же через роутер, когда отправляю команды через ssh или scp
сначала авторизируюсь echo oleg>/dev/ttyATH0 (пароль oleg) и по индикаторам вижу что авторизация прошла как нужно. Кстати заметил, если через ардуино отправлять пароль авторизации, то он должен выглядеть только oleg и никак по другому, а когда отпраляю через консоль в роутер то может и так echo 11oleg1>/dev/ttyATH0 и тоже авторизируется.
Дальше когда хочу проверить моторы отправляю команды
echo 1>/dev/ttyATH0
echo 2>/dev/ttyATH0
echo 4>/dev/ttyATH0
echo 8>/dev/ttyATH0
что б сравнить правильно ли работает все теперь.
Но светодиоды горят не так, а точнее что б я не отправлял горят только на 50 и 52 порту

Часть кода из ардуино, что б стало понятно
PORTB_val = in_char & 0x0F; //позволяет обращаться к портам PB0...PB7 (это порты 53,52,51,50,10,11,12,13 в той же последовательности) одновременно, в ту же секунду, (моторы) 00001111


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 07:51 
Не в сети
Аватара пользователя

Зарегистрирован: 10 ноя 2011, 12:02
Сообщения: 5691
Откуда: Turku, Finland
Skype: elmot73
прог. языки: Java и все-все=все
ФИО: Илья
Rolf74 писал(а):
echo 1>/dev/ttyATH0
echo 2>/dev/ttyATH0
echo 4>/dev/ttyATH0
echo 8>/dev/ttyATH0
что б сравнить правильно ли работает все теперь.

Пробелы ставь после цифр. Это как минимум. Иначе оно делает совсем не то, что ты ожидаешь.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 07:59 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
Если понял правильно, то вводить нужно так
echo 2(пробел)>/dev/ttyATH0
или так
echo 2 (пробелпробелпробел) >/dev/ttyATH0
а возможно даже так
echo (пробелпробелпробел) 2( пробелпробелпробел) >/dev/ttyATH0


(пробел) = нормальный пробел, просто на форуме много пробелов выдает за 1 :lol:

Тоже самое все, не помогло.. :(


p.s. даже если отправить echo >/dev/ttyATH0 пустое сообщение то светодиоды будут гореть все те же 50, 52


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 10:42 
Не в сети
Аватара пользователя

Зарегистрирован: 10 ноя 2011, 12:02
Сообщения: 5691
Откуда: Turku, Finland
Skype: elmot73
прог. языки: Java и все-все=все
ФИО: Илья
Какая скорость выставлена на дуине?
попробуй залить туда эхо - пишем в уарт то, что оттуда читаем.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 11:06 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
В дуине
Serial3.begin(9600);

И в роутере в автозапуске
/usr/sbin/setserial /dev/ttyATH0 irq 3
/usr/bin/stty -F /dev/ttyATH0 raw speed 9600


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 11:31 
Не в сети
Аватара пользователя

Зарегистрирован: 10 ноя 2011, 12:02
Сообщения: 5691
Откуда: Turku, Finland
Skype: elmot73
прог. языки: Java и все-все=все
ФИО: Илья
Rolf74 писал(а):
И в роутере в автозапуске
/usr/sbin/setserial /dev/ttyATH0 irq 3

Убери этот ужос.
Rolf74 писал(а):
/usr/bin/stty -F /dev/ttyATH0 raw speed 9600

Это не поможет. Убрать и поправить ser2net.conf


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 12:11 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
в сер2нет настроил
1500:raw:600:/dev/ttyATH0:9600 NONE 1STOPBIT 8DATABITS -XONXOFF LOCAL -RTSCTS


/usr/bin/stty -F /dev/ttyATH0 raw speed 9600 - удалил, перестало проходить авторизацию, помогало, когда строчка была


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 18 май 2012, 12:42 
Не в сети
Аватара пользователя

Зарегистрирован: 10 ноя 2011, 12:02
Сообщения: 5691
Откуда: Turku, Finland
Skype: elmot73
прог. языки: Java и все-все=все
ФИО: Илья
а, это локальное эхо... Ладно, пусть стоит.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 20 май 2012, 02:36 
Не в сети
Аватара пользователя

Зарегистрирован: 09 май 2011, 16:43
Сообщения: 536
Откуда: Украина, Киев
прог. языки: Нецензурный
ФИО: Евгений НеОН
По поводу антенн: СВЧ (а 2.4 ГГц это таки СВЧ) - это не детекторный приёмник, тут увеличить чувствительность и дальность простым "лонгвайр" не выйдет. Думается мне, что выходной каскад трансивера, что стоит в данном роутере рассчитан под подобные антенны. Да и вообще, каждый сантиметр кабеля придётся компенсировать эффективностью антенны, ибо затухание.

_________________
Никогда не бойся делать то, что ты не умеешь. Ковчег был сооружен любителем. Профессионалы построили “Титаник“
2:5020/2140.1979@fidonet


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 26 июл 2012, 17:16 
Не в сети
Аватара пользователя

Зарегистрирован: 27 дек 2011, 11:58
Сообщения: 59
Откуда: Украина
Skype: rolf7474
Вот неплохой вариант сделать в mr3020 внешнюю антенну External Antenna Hack
Как минимум роутер уже можно прятать в середине устройства и не беспокоится о потере сигнала.
Интересно усилит ли это сигнал, может кто пробовал?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: WiFi робот руками чайника
СообщениеДобавлено: 31 июл 2012, 21:05 
Не в сети
Аватара пользователя

Зарегистрирован: 26 июл 2012, 18:40
Сообщения: 263
Откуда: Екатеринбург
Даа, робот классный. Но у меня вопрос про стабилизатор-был использован К142ЕН5А или КР142ЕН5А?
судя по всему КР142ЕН5А- http://yandex.ru/yandsearch?text=%D0%9A ... 0%90&lr=54
http://yandex.ru/yandsearch?text=%D0%9A ... 0%90&lr=54
http://tec.org.ru/board/kr142en5a/94-1-0-912


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 260 ]  На страницу Пред.  1 ... 7, 8, 9, 10, 11, 12, 13 ... 18  След.

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 3


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
phpBB SEO